Join us on this captivating journey in the heart of West Virginia, where we focus on two main areas around New River National Park and Canaan Valley National Wildlife Refuge. Birds will be in their brightest colors and full song on their territories at this confluence of southern and northern woodland breeders. Plus, throughout our time in the field, we’ll likely encounter mammals, reptiles, and amphibians, and enjoy orchids, carnivorous plants, and plentiful wildflowers. We’ll take our time to fully immerse ourselves in each location we visit, and take advantage of a slow pace to delight in sightings big and small.

We’ll focus on two main areas: New River National Park – our nation’s newest national park, named after what’s actually a very old river – and Canaan Valley National Wildlife Refuge, an expansive high-elevation wetland ecosystem. This convergence will provide us with opportunities for a combination of southeast US breeding birds like Swainson’s, Kentucky, and Yellow-throated Warblers and White-eyed Vireo; northern and western mountain breeding birds including Golden-winged and Mourning Warbler, Northern Waterthrush, Winter Wren, and Swainson’s Thrush; and prairie species such as Henslow’s and Grasshopper Sparrow and Bobolink. Warblers will be the stars of the show, and we can expect 30+ species throughout our tour.
